轻量应用服务器是一种云服务器产品,它提供了易于管理和部署的环境,适合小型到中型的应用程序。以下是关于轻量应用服务器特价活动的基础概念、优势、类型、应用场景以及可能遇到的问题和解决方案:
轻量应用服务器是一种预配置的虚拟服务器,通常包含操作系统、Web服务器、数据库等基础软件,用户可以快速启动和使用。
特价活动通常包括以下几种形式:
原因:可能是由于服务器配置不足或网络带宽限制。 解决方案:
原因:未及时更新软件补丁或配置不当。 解决方案:
原因:应用程序负载过高或数据库查询效率低下。 解决方案:
import sqlite3
# 原始低效查询
def inefficient_query():
conn = sqlite3.connect('example.db')
cursor = conn.cursor()
cursor.execute("SELECT * FROM large_table")
results = cursor.fetchall()
conn.close()
return results
# 优化后的查询
def efficient_query():
conn = sqlite3.connect('example.db')
cursor = conn.cursor()
cursor.execute("SELECT id, name FROM large_table WHERE active = 1")
results = cursor.fetchall()
conn.close()
return results
通过上述优化,可以显著减少数据库的负载,提高查询效率。
希望这些信息对你有所帮助!如果有更多具体问题,欢迎继续咨询。
领取专属 10元无门槛券
手把手带您无忧上云